What you should know about Mont Boron.
Mont Boron is best known for being home to Fort du Mont Alban, among the best-preserved sixteenth-century military fortifications on the French Riviera.
Constructed between 1557 and 1560 under the Duchy of Savoy, the fort was strategically positioned to monitor and defend both the ports of Nice and Villefranche-sur-Mer. Its elevated location provided military commanders with exceptional visibility across the coastline, making it among the region's most important defensive structures during a period of frequent maritime conflict. Despite centuries of political and military change, the fort has remained remarkably intact, preserving much of its original architectural character. The site continues to offer some of the most celebrated panoramic views on the CΓ΄te d'Azur while serving as a reminder of the region's strategic significance. Today, Fort du Mont Alban remains one of southeastern France's most important military heritage landmarks and a defining symbol of Mont Boron. How to fold Mont Boron into your trip.
Mont Boron is best experienced as an exploration of the scenic landmarks, historic fortifications, and natural landscapes that define one of the French Riviera's most spectacular hillside districts.
Begin at Fort du Mont Alban, where the neighborhood's defining connection to military history and panoramic beauty immediately comes into focus. Continue toward Parc du Mont Boron, whose forested trails and scenic viewpoints reveal the natural character that has shaped the district for generations. From there, make your way to Sentier du Littoral, where dramatic coastal perspectives and Mediterranean landscapes provide a broader perspective on the environmental beauty that continues to define Mont Boron today. Along the route, you'll encounter protected woodlands, luxury villas, scenic overlooks, historic fortifications, walking trails, coastal viewpoints, and tranquil public spaces that showcase the neighborhood's remarkable depth. The progression moves naturally from historic fortress to hillside park to coastal pathway, revealing the forces that shaped the neighborhood.
